Functional Pin Description
Pin No.
RT9014-□□PQW
RT9014A-□□
Pin
Name
Pin Function
1
1
VIN
Supply Input.
2
--
EN
Chip Enable (Active High).
--
2
EN1
Chip Enable 1 (Active High).
--
3
EN2
Chip Enable 2 (Active High).
3
--
NC
No Internal Connection Pin.
4
4
SW
Active high signal drives open-drain N-MOSFET.
Note that this pin is high impedance. There should be a pull low
100k
Ω resistor connected to GND when the control signal is
floating.
5
5
SET
Delay Set Input: Connect external capacitor to GND to set the
internal delay for the POR output. When left open, there is no
delay. This pin cannot be grounded.
6
6
GND
Common Ground.
7
7
DRV
Open-Drain Output: Capable of sinking 150mA.
8
8
POR
Power-On Reset Output: Open-drain output. Active low indicates
an output under-voltage condition on regulator 2.
9
9
VOUT2 Channel 2 Output Voltage
10
10
VOUT1 Channel 1 Output Voltage
Exposed Pad (11) Exposed Pad (11) GND
The exposed pad must be soldered to a large PCB and
connected to GND for maximum power dissipation.
